About Tile Installer Jobs in Riverside, CA
Riverside has emerged as a growing hub for construction and skilled trades, making it an excellent market for tile installers seeking steady employment. The city's booming real estate development, driven by both residential expansion and commercial projects throughout the region, has created consistent demand for experienced tile work professionals. Whether you're looking to find tile installer work in Riverside or considering a move to the area, you'll find that the job market remains relatively strong compared to many other regions in California. The Riverside-San Bernardino-Ontario metropolitan area continues to see new construction projects, home renovations, and commercial buildouts that all require skilled tile installers to complete kitchens, bathrooms, and decorative installations.
When searching for tile installer jobs in Riverside, CA, candidates can expect competitive compensation that reflects both the local cost of living and the specialized nature of the work. Most experienced tile installers in the area earn between $50,000 and $75,000 annually, with some senior installers or those running their own businesses earning considerably more. Employers in Riverside are typically looking for professionals with proven installation experience, knowledge of different tile materials and installation methods, attention to detail, and the ability to read blueprints and maintain safety standards. The best candidates also demonstrate reliability, strong communication skills, and the capacity to work efficiently on both residential and commercial projects. Many employers value certifications from tile industry associations and experience with modern installation techniques.
